Anonim

新しいプログラムやゲームを購入して、インストールしようとしたときに「アプリケーションは正しく起動できませんでした0xc00007b」エラーが表示されるほどイライラすることはほとんどありません。 あなたがしたいのは、あなたの購入をインストールして遊ぶことです。 代わりに、フォーラムをトロールして、このエラーの解決策を見つける必要があります。 もう違います。 ソリューションは、実際には、いくつかの、手元にあります。

このエラーが表示される場合、Windowsコンピューターに何かをインストールしている途中である可能性があります。 そのインストールは停止し、「アプリケーションは0xc00007bを正しく起動できませんでした」というポップアップウィンドウが表示されます。 アプリケーションを閉じるには、[OK]をクリックしてください。」

このエラーが表示される理由はいくつかあります。

  1. インストールの一部またはコンピューター上の.NET Frameworkファイルの問題。
  2. 32ビットと64ビットのファイルまたは環境の混在。
  3. 上記に問題があるとWindowsに思わせるインストールファイルの欠落または破損。

これらすべての原因のうち、.NET Frameworkファイルが最も一般的です。

.NET Frameworkは何ですか?

.NET Frameworkは、年のための私達とされています。 アプリ開発者の作業を楽にするために設計されたAPIの集まりです。 Microsoftは、すべてを最初からコーディングし、すべてのアプリのダウンロードにすべての依存関係を含めるのではなく、コード自体をインストールすることなくアプリがそこからリソースを呼び出すことができるように.NET Frameworkを設計しました。

.NET Frameworkは、アプリが内部で実行されるランタイム環境でもあります。 仮想マシンのように考えてください。 ホストから分離しますが、ホストのリソースを使用します。 意図は、開発者が好きなコードを使用できるようにすることであり、それでもWindows内で実行されます。 C ++、Visual Basic、および他のいくつかの言語でアプリをコンパイルでき、.NET Frameworkはそれらをすべて同じように実行します。

「アプリケーションは正しく起動できませんでした0xc00007b」エラーを修正する方法

多くの0xc00007bエラーは、.NETファイルの欠落または破損が原因です。 具体的には、フレームワーク内のC ++ファイルの欠落または破損。 これは、アプリケーションをインストールしているときに発生し、コンピューターで同様のアプリケーションを実行していない場合は、通常、Windowsインストーラーがインストール済みバージョンを認識または利用できないことを意味します。 既存のプログラムで完全に使用できる場合でも、インストーラーでは使用できません。 したがって、エラー。

新しいコピーをダウンロードすることで、すぐにこれに対処できます。

ここから.NET Framework全体をインストールするか、x32バージョンまたはx64バージョンからMicrosoft Visual C ++をインストールします。 私は最初のMicrosoft Visual C ++バージョンを試すことをお勧め。 古いバージョンのWindowsを実行している場合はx32を選択し、64ビット互換プロセッサーを備えたWindows 10を実行している場合はx64を選択します。

あなたは64ビットプログラムを実行することができますかどうかを確認するには:

  1. 右のWindowsの[スタート]ボタンを選択し[設定]をクリックします。
  2. システムを選択し、について。
  3. 右ペインで情報を確認してください。 「64ビットオペレーティングシステム、x64プロセッサ」などのように表示されるはずです。

Microsoft Visual C ++をインストールしたら、インストールを再試行すると、動作するはずです。

「アプリケーションは0xc00007bを正しく開始できませんでした」エラーを修正する他の方法

ほとんどの場合、プログラムがWindowsのバージョンと互換性があり、Microsoft Visual C ++を再インストールした場合、インストールしようとしているプログラムは正常に動作するはずです。 いくつかのケースでは、あなたはまだ問題がある場合があります。 ここでは、それらを修正しようとすることができますいくつかあります。

  1. 32ビットまたは64ビットのダウンロードのオプションがある場合は、必ず正しいものを選択してください。
  2. インストール中に管理者としてログインしていることを確認してください。
  3. ウイルス対策またはマルウェアスキャナーをオフにして、インストールを再試行します。
  4. インストール.exeファイルを右クリックし、「管理者として実行」を選択します。
  5. Microsoftの.NET Frameworkの修復ツールを実行します。
  6. ゲームをインストールしようとしている場合は、MicrosoftからDirectXを再インストールしてください。
  7. 破損している可能性があるため、プログラムまたはゲームのインストールファイルを再ダウンロードします。

一部のWebサイトでは、単純な再起動またはハードドライブのエラーのスキャンを推奨しています。 多くの状況で役立ちますが、ここではあまり良くありません。 コンピューターが他のプログラムを正常に実行し、このインストールでのみ問題がある場合、インストールファイルに何か問題があることを意味します。 それが破損のように機械的に間違っているのか、それとも.NET Frameworkファイルを読み取れないという点で単純に間違っているのかは、議論の余地があります。

どちらの方法でも、.NET Framework全体をMicrosoft Visual C ++から再インストールするか、Microsoft Visual C ++のみを再インストールして、インストールを再試行すると正常に機能します。 そうでない場合は、リストされている他の修正のいずれかまたはすべてを試してみると、すぐに起動して実行できるはずです!

Windows 10で「アプリケーションが0xc00007bを正しく起動できなかった」を修正する方法